                    Figure 27-5  •  A, Lateral and ventrodorsal (B) views of the thorax of a ferret that sustained serious chest injuries after a small child tripped
                    and fell on it. The lateral projection is the most informative, revealing an abnormally dense, smaller than normal caudal lobe with an
                    exceptionally clear border. This appearance is indicative of a ruptured lung lobe with a secondary pneumothorax.
